Thunder vs. Knicks Prediction
Are the Thunder a good bet to pull off the small upset tonight when they visit the Knicks at 7:30PM ET?
According to oddsmakers from online sports book Bovada.lv, the Knicks are 1-point home underdogs versus the Thunder while the over/under currently sits at 213.5 points. Oklahoma City enters play with a 10-8 record (3-4 on the road) and is 8-10 against the spread, while New York is 8-8 overall (7-2 at home) and 9-7 at the betting window in 2016.
THUNDER KEY TRENDS: The Thunder are 9-4 against the spread in their last 13 games when playing on Monday, but they have really struggled as an underdog. They have dropped eight of 10 games as a road underdog and are 1-6 at the betting window in their last six games in which they’re an underdog of between 0.5 and 4.5 points. They’re also just 2-8 against the spread in their last 10 road games overall.
KNICKS KEY TRENDS: The Knicks are a perfect 4-0 against the spread in their last four games and are 6-0 against the number in their last six home games. They’ve also covered in nine of their last 12 games when playing on one day of rest and are 4-0 at the betting window in their last four games after scoring 100 points or more in their previous contest.

OUR PREDICTION: It’s hard to bet against the Knicks at home right now. Carmelo Anthony is averaging 24.4 points at home this season, while posting a 21.1 PPG average on the road. New York has to figure out a way to contain the red-hot Russell Westbrook, who is seek his third straight triple-double, but the Knicks should be up for the challenge. The Thunder is just 1-5 against the spread in their last six road games versus an opponent with a winning home record and are 6-18 at the betting window in their last 24 games versus teams from the Atlantic.
MONDAY NBA PREDICTION: NEW YORK KNICKS -1
